Needville High School
Needville High School is a public high school located in unincorporated area, unincorporated Fort Bend County, Texas, Fort Bend County, Texas (with a Needville, Texas, Needville postal address) and a part of the Needville Independent School District. It is classified as a 4A school by the University Interscholastic League, UIL. The school serves residents of Needville, Fairchilds, Texas, Fairchilds, a portion of Pleak, Texas, Pleak, and the unincorporated communities of Guy, Texas, Guy and Long Point, Texas, Long Point. In 2015, the school was rated "Texas Education Agency accountability ratings system, Met Standard" by the Texas Education Agency. Students in grades 9-12 from the neighboring Damon Independent School District also attended Needville High School prior to the opening of Damon High School. Long Point, Texas
Long Point is an unincorporated area in Fort Bend County, Texas, United States. It is located southeast of Richmond, Texas at the intersection of Farm to Market Road 1994 (FM 1994) and FM 361. There is no road sign identifying the community, though the nearby roads carry its name. Petroleum and sulphur were extracted near the community in the 1930s. Electric transmission towers pass through the site and a county landfill is located to the northeast. History According to local lore, Long Point was named for a point of timber that jutted into the prairie near the site. The Texas State Handbook says that a community was founded here in 1850 on land formerly owned by Stephen F. Austin. The name was written initially as Longpoint, but was changed to Long Point by the first postmaster, Wayne Bishop on February 19, 1851. Damon Independent School District
Damon Independent School District is a public school district based in Damon, Texas (USA). History The date of establishment of the first school, located near an oil field, was not recorded; the 1900 Galveston hurricane destroyed this school. A replacement building opened shortly afterwards, and in 1921 a two-story building located between the current townsite and the former townsite opened. Damon High School opened in 1924. Guy, Texas
Guy is an unincorporated community in Fort Bend County, Texas, United States. It is located on Texas State Highway 36 (SH 36) about south of Rosenberg, Texas. A trucking company, a Shell Oil Company filling station, a post office, and several homes are located near the intersection of SH 36 and Farm to Market Road 1994 (FM 1994). The community was established in 1890 and was served by a railroad between 1918 and the 1980s. Geography Guy is at an elevation of above sea level and the surrounding terrain is remarkably flat. The community is centered at the intersection of SH 36 and FM 1994. Needville High School is located on SH 36 northwest on the outskirts of the city of Needville. The Guy Public Cemetery is found northeast on FM 1994 and Long Point is farther to the northeast. Damon in Brazoria County is located southeast on SH 36.
